NIIC Announces Baseball All-Conference

AURORA, Ill. May 17, 2005 - The Northern Illinois-Iowa Conference announced the 2005 baseball All-Conference team. Aurora University’s Spartan baseball team, conference champions and tournament champions, placed six players on the Northern Illinois-Iowa Conference (NIIC) All-Conference team and two Honorable Mention NIIC All Conference.

Senior outfielder Jay Lavender (Oswego, Ill./Oswego HS), senior first baseman Brian Chelgren (Munster, Ind./Thornwood HS), senior third baseman Brian Brandenburg (Batavia, Ill./Batavia HS), junior outfielder John Hopkins (Lockport, Ill./Lockport HS), junior pitcher Brady Salter (Plainfield, Ill./Plainfield Central HS), and sophomore outfielder Jay Zimmerman (Plainfield, Ill./Plainfield Central HS) were named First-Team All-Conference by the NIIC baseball coaches. Senior pitcher George Creviston (Rockford, Ill./Guilford HS) and junior shortstop Aaron Thor (Rockford, Ill./Guilford HS) were named Honorable Mention NIIC All-Conference.

In conference action, Lavender led AU with a .493 batting average with 11 doubles, one triple, three home runs, 25 runs batted in, and 26 runs scored; Chelgren hit .403 with five doubles, one triple, two home runs, 22 runs batted in, and 19 runs scored; Brandenburg hit .458 with four doubles, three home runs, 22 runs batted in, and 23 runs scored; Hopkins hit .448 with seven doubles, one home run, and 27 runs scored; Salter was 5-0 with a 3.48 earned run average, and 25 strikeouts in 33-2/3 innings pitched; while Zimmerman hit .446 with five doubles, four home runs, 24 runs batted in, and 24 runs scored. While Honorable Mention selections Creviston had a 3-1 record with a 3.68 earned run average and 27 strikeouts in 29-1/3 innings pitched and Thor hit .361 with eight doubles, three home runs, 23 runs batted in, and 20 runs scored.

AU’s baseball team is currently 34-7 on the season and finished 14-4 in the NIIC, while capturing the regular-season conference championship and their second consecutive Conference Tournament Championship, which carried the NIIC automatic bid into the 2005 NCAA Division III baseball championships.

The AU baseball team is in action in the NCAA tournament on Thursday, May 19, 2005, at the Central Regional in Bloomington, Ill. The Spartans are the No. 1 seed in the six-team regional and will take on No. 6 seed Ripon College. Game time for AU is set at 12:00 p.m. (noon) at Illinois Wesleyan University in Bloomington, Ill.
